how to find hostname from ip address in linux

"Sudo unable to resolve host" is a problem that some users see. To view the purposes they believe they have legitimate interest for, or to object to this data processing use the vendor list link below. The term hostname is used for computer name and website name. Chris Down and Heinzi briefly discussed the case where the hostname resolves to more than one IP addresses. maybe he'll post back with more info. Execute ip addr on the terminal. Stack Exchange network consists of 181 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share their knowledge, and build their careers. [System.Net.Dns]::GetHostByAddress (<ip_address>).Hostname Thanks in advance! By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Relation between transaction data and transaction id. If you use a Linux operating system, then to run the console, use the Ctrl+Alt+T keyboard shortcut. To find the IP address of Facebook, open the command prompt and choose Facebook from the list. How do you ensure that a red herring doesn't violate Chekhov's gun? There are a couple of ways of doing it on both Windows and Linux. Spice (17) Reply (24) The third method used for searching the hostname is the nslookup command. Use the nslookup command with the IP address of your system:if(typeof ez_ad_units != 'undefined'){ez_ad_units.push([[300,250],'itslinuxfoss_com-large-mobile-banner-1','ezslot_8',174,'0','0'])};__ez_fad_position('div-gpt-ad-itslinuxfoss_com-large-mobile-banner-1-0'); The hostname will be printed on the screen.if(typeof ez_ad_units != 'undefined'){ez_ad_units.push([[728,90],'itslinuxfoss_com-large-mobile-banner-2','ezslot_10',173,'0','0'])};__ez_fad_position('div-gpt-ad-itslinuxfoss_com-large-mobile-banner-2-0'); To set the hostname in Linux, run the given command in the terminal: Once you run the command above, the following interface will be opened. The hostname command is actually used to display the host name of a system. To find a hostname on the internet you could use the host program: host <ip> Or you can install nbtscan by running: sudo apt-get install nbtscan And use: nbtscan <ip> *Adapted from https://askubuntu.com/questions/205063/command-to-get-the-hostname-of-remote-server-using-ip-address/205067#205067 Update 2018-05-13 You can see in the above screenshot that we will get the hostname www.javatpoint.com from the IP address 194.169.80.121. Solution 4. We simply don't have enough info to say anything definitive regarding that.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. mycomputer. Linux. bible readings for funerals church of england, 2022 denbighshire cold weather payment Out of all the stuff above, it's the only one that worked for me. Type. Will Gnome 43 be included in the upgrades of 22.04 Jammy? For mac users smbutil -v status -ae x.x.x.x . On running the nslookup command with a hostname, it has returned the Name, Addresses, and Aliases. I'd like to get remote machine/hostname through IP Address. rev2023.3.3.43278. To find out the name of a computer by its IP address, you can use the command nslookup. See the syntax to run on command prompt (CMD). If the user knows the IP address of a system, then it can easily get its host/domain name associated with it. Type.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2, how to find host name from IP with out login to the host. You can also use arp -a to get mac addresses for everything on your network. Copy and run the above command to see the response. Run the nslookup command with an IP address from which you want to get the hostname. The domain name mba01s07-in-f14.1 e100.net has a root of 216.58.223.78, and the host is 76.224.215.1e100. Then, youll need to type the command nslookup followed by the IP address youd like to resolve. i didn't say ping was the best way, i said it was a way. If you use Windows, you can easily find the hostname of your computer system by typing a command on the command prompt (CMD). West Virginia Medical School Mcat, The ip command is available on most Linux distributions. The output of nslookup is piped into the grep command, which is used to extract the line containing the string 'name ='. Most of us know that an IP address of the system can be known by running a simple command. The hostname will be labeled as Host Name. The hostname of Facebook is www.javatpoint.com. and many systems use zeroconf to synchronize names between multiple naming systems. To find your public IP address, reach out to an external website. @mh& @izzy: i'm not debating that nslookup is not the proper tool to use. Type the following hostnamectl command if you are using systemd based Linux distro: ifconfig eth0 192.168.125.10 netmask 255.255.255.0 up. ), Bulk update symbol size units from mm to map units in rule-based symbology. The dig is beneficial for diagnosing the server names, checking all available DNS records, and much more. In this case (and others below), basic scripting under the assumption that a hostname directly resolves to a single IP address may break. Continue with Recommended Cookies. The hostname is used to address hosts by using canonical names. and what would happen then? It will simply display the IP address of the host in the terminal. A black box opens. Allowed wsl through . How to find all files containing specific text (string) on Linux? For more information, see Connect to your Linux instance. So to get one of the IP address directly, below command can be used. Method-1: Check HostName using /etc/hostname file Alternatively, we can view the hostname by using the /etc/hostname file. You will see which IP is bound to which interface in the command output. Note that 8.8.8.8 is the IP address of Google. ifconfig command: It is used to configure the kernel-resident network interfaces as well as display information about it. Developed by JavaTpoint. For example, nslookup: the classic way to find the IP address from a hostname or vice-versa. Note: The IP address used in this post is 1922.168.59.132. This post has briefly illustrated all the possible ways to get the hostname/domain name from the IP address. Critical issues have been reported with the following SDK versions: com.google.android.gms:play-services-safetynet:17.0.0, Flutter Dart - get localized country name from country code, navigatorState is null when using pushNamed Navigation onGenerateRoutes of GetMaterialPage, Android Sdk manager not found- Flutter doctor error, Flutter Laravel Push Notification without using any third party like(firebase,onesignal..etc), How to change the color of ElevatedButton when entering text in TextField. Follow Up: struct sockaddr storage initialization by network format-string, Linear regulator thermal information missing in datasheet. Click on Accessories. We will tell you how you can get the hostname of a website from an IP address. The 'hostname' command can be used to change the hostname of the system as well. You need to use the router command command. [ Free download: Advanced Linux commands cheat sheet. ] Execute ip addr on the terminal. The hostname "ubuntu" is printed on the screen. Specify a hostname or IP Address. Below, an example with a hostname resolving to more than a single IP address: Method # 1: Using IP address command. Map IP to hostname in linux. How to Find UUID of Storage Devices in Linux. ip command: Display or manipulate IP address, routing, devices, policy routing and tunnels.This command can show ip address on a CentOS or RHEL servers. Can somebody point out how in which cases AD DS still relies on Netbios? In CMD, there is a syntax for running the program. williamsville central school district salary schedule; vw passat estate boot space dimensions; hawthorne elementary school nj; walgreens north ave pharmacy Solution 1. host IP-ADDRESS host 192.168.1.1 2. dig -x IP-ADDRESS dig -x 192.168.1.1 3. nslookup IP-ADDRESS nslookup 192.168.1.1 4. ping -a IP-ADDRESS ping -a 192.168.1.1 find hostname hostname ip address PING can result in inaccurate results, especially if you're actively working on DNS issues. I have a machine named test and using IP 10.1.27.97, but I used the method above still can't not get "test". To find the IP address of Facebook, open the command prompt and choose Facebook from the list. Multiple ways to get IP address from hostname in Linux and Windows, How Intuit democratizes AI development across teams through reusability. For more information about SSH keys, see SSH It can also be used to print gateway/router IP address. www.Facebook.com is the domain name of Facebook. ping to get the IP address of a running Windows machine. Some of our partners may process your data as a part of their legitimate business interest without asking for consent. Note: When you connect to VMs using the Google Cloud console, Compute Engine creates an ephemeral SSH key for you. Save my name, email, and website in this browser for the next time I comment. Ping will use the local DNS Resolver Cache, which may be incorrect until you flush. The second command you can use to find an IP address is the ip addr command. On a mac device go to System Preferences. Charlie Brown Dance Move Gif, . hostname -i on Linux. Another method you can try is to dig. Similarly, hostname helps to identify a machine or website by its hostname. There have been talks that Netbios bound to be depricate since Windows Server 2003 times. Finding the hostname of a computer with a private IP address and no local DNS server means you need to query the host itself by using a Windows utility. How can I recursively find all files in current and subfolders based on wildcard matching? What is the purpose of non-series Shimano components? @Izzy I registered as a new member just to say thanks for the tip for NSLOOKUP, Izzy. Does anyone can help me to get the hostname form IP Address? Find Hostname From IP with nslookup Command (Windows,Linux,MacOS) The nslookup command is used to resolve between IP address and domain name. NBTSTAT does rely on having NetBIOS loaded and running, which is often switched off in larger organisations with their own AD & DNS infrastructure. The ping command is very popular and cross-platform command which is used to check remote hosts and network connectivity.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Change all three names with hostnamectl The procedure is as follows: Open the terminal app or login using ssh to host server; Get the network list: virsh net-list; Type the command: virsh net-dhcp-leases networkNameHere; Let us see steps in details. Using hostname command. The question is how to get hostname of a specific IP address in the same Windows workgroup? Linux On Linux, retrieving your IP address is as simple as using the following command in the terminal. Alternatively, to find your private IP address, bring up the terminal window and enter the Show IP command "ifconfig." To find a hostname in your local network by IP address you can use nmblookup from the samba suite: To find a hostname on the internet you could use the host program: *Adapted from https://askubuntu.com/questions/205063/command-to-get-the-hostname-of-remote-server-using-ip-address/205067#205067. Python3 import socket print(socket.gethostbyname (socket.gethostname ())) Output: 10.143.90.178 Method 2: Using socket.socket instance Here, two parameters were supplied to a socket instance that was created. The first two commands are used to lookup NetBIOS names. But if you are a non-technical user, it is almost impossible to write the Java code and get the hostname from IP. thank you all ! Because small business networks typically use private IP addresses, you can only see a computers hostname if the network has a local DNS server. See the syntax to run on command prompt (CMD). Once you hit enter, the hostname associated with the IP address will appear. On a mac device go to System Preferences. The best way to check your hostname is to use the 'hostname' command. In this article, we will explain how to resolve a hostname/domain name to an IPv4 and IPv6 address in a Bash To do this, type the following into the command line: Linux. Styling contours by colour and by line thickness in QGIS. Does it still somehow required now with Windows Server 2012 AD DS networks? If youd like to find the IP address associated with a hostname, you can use the same command, replacing the IP address with the hostname. I have one host running Kubuntu 9.04. In addition, the dig command is also beneficial for performing this task. Learn more about Stack Overflow the company, and our products. Following is another command to get the hostname of your computer. also, as far as i'm concerned there's no correct or incorrect way of doing it. It can also be used to display the IP address of the host: hostname -I. Proxy servers are intended to increase the speed of your connection with the help of caching. On the internet, each server has a public-facing IP address, which is assigned directly to the server or via a router that sends network traffic to that server. The IP address of Twitter returned by the ping command is 104.244.42.1. For a more complete rundown, see Deprecated Linux networking commands and their replacements.. iproute2. Your IP replacement in the process is just a sideway action rather than a main purpose of proxies, and they can be easily detected. In the Google Cloud console, go to the VM instances page. How do I prompt for Yes/No/Cancel input in a Linux shell script? An example of data being processed may be a unique identifier stored in a cookie. This command works a bit differently from the ping command that is discussed above. Then enter %ipaddress% as the IP address for which you want to find the hostname in the black box that appears on the screen. nmblookup might not work well for Linux hosts, because the NetBIOS name is deprecated. This command can manipulate the kernels IP routing tables. To do so, open the Terminal and type the below command in it: $ ip r. In the output below, you can see the IP address of the system. Another simple way I found for using in LAN is, If you need to login command line will be. Finding the hostname of a computer with a private IP address and no local DNS server means you need to query the host itself by using a Windows utility. An IP address is a computers location on a network, either locally or on the internet. Here are the steps to follow: Click on the Window Start button. My code is GPL licensed, can I issue a license to have my code be distributed in a specific MIT licensed project?

Mountaingate Country Club Celebrity Members, Revise The Following Sentences To Unbury The Verbs, Port Clinton News Herald Obituaries, Natalie Lizarraga Height, Articles H

how to find hostname from ip address in linux

how to find hostname from ip address in linuxLatest videos